About

Carlene Nicol is a senior associate in the firm’s Employment team. Carlene advises employers on all areas of employment law (contentious and non-contentious).

She has extensive experience in: advising on all aspects of the employment lifecycle; advising on and negotiating the employment aspects of business transfers and outsourcings; defending employment litigation (with substantive experience in defending equal pay claims); advising on senior executive and partnership issues; the implementation of large-scale, local and international projects and change programmes; and advising on the application of regulatory requirements in the financial services sector.

Carlene has worked in the UK and Hong Kong.

She advises a multitude of local and global clients, with a particular focus on those in the technology and digital and financial services sectors.

Experience

  • US Tech Company: key employment adviser in large acquisition acting for well-known US multinational technology corporation.
  • BBC: two-year client secondment (August 2018 – August 2020) to the BBC, working on critical equal pay work. Work cumulated in key findings by EHRC that there was no unlawful pay discrimination in the cases analysed during its investigation.
  • Employment Litigation: advising on key TUPE case, exploring complexities in advantageous contractual changes.
  • Financial Sector: acting on behalf of a Main List company, reg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ority, in relation to a high stakes unfair dismissal and breach of contract claim which progressed in both the Employment Tribunal and the High Court.
